Am Donnerstag, 17. April 2025, 16:36:44 Mitteleuropäische Sommerzeit schrieb Yao Zi:
> Registers of MMC drive/sample clocks in Rockchip RV1106 and RK3528
> locate in GRF regions. Adjust MMC clock code to support register
> operations through regmap. Also add a helper to ease registration of GRF
> clocks.

please don't create separate structures for specific clock-types.
Being able to "just define" clock branches is helpful and starting
to require separate blocks just causes issues down the road.
For handling multiple GRF sources, I just merged Nicolas' patches for
handling auxiliary GRFs [0] and GRF-gate clock type [1] .
So ideally, please base off from there.
